In a groundbreaking development for artificial intelligence and web search technology, ChatGPT’s search feature is experiencing explosive growth across Europe. This innovative tool, which enables the AI chatbot to access and integrate current web information into its responses, is reshaping how users interact with online data.
Recent reports from OpenAI Ireland Limited, one of OpenAI’s European corporate divisions, reveal staggering figures: ChatGPT search boasts an impressive average of 41.3 million monthly active users, categorized as “recipients” in the report. This substantial user base underscores the rapid adoption and trust that European internet users are placing in AI-driven search capabilities.
